About the Book

Oracle performance tuning is a part of the management and administration of successful database systems. One of the biggest responsiblities of a database administrator (DBA) is to ensure that the Oracle database is tuned properly. A poorly performing database can cost a company thousands or millions of pounds in lost business or lost income. Covering the latest version of Oracle - Oracle 9i - this book is aimed at the database administrator who wants to find out how to fine tune and configure his/her system. The book covers hardware as well as software issues. The reader is trained in proper developer application development from the user's point of view.
